본문 바로가기
[개발] Info/소개

Tomcat 인코딩 문제

by Devsong26 2018. 4. 19.

Tomcat을 기동하고 나서 웹 페이지를 작업을 하면 서버 쪽에서 영어 이외의 문자들이 ??? 로 나오는 경우가 있다. 

 

찾아보니 server.xml에는 URIEncoding="UTF-8"을 입력하고, web.xml에는 UTF-8 Filter를 설정해줘야 한다는 이야기가 많았지만 시도해 보니 나의 경우에는 해결돼지 않았다.

 

해결방법은 Tomcat의 Java영역의 옵션을 바꿔야 했다.

 

톰캣 매니저를 실행하여 Java 탭을 클릭 후 Java Options 부분에 

"-Dfile.encoding=UTF-8"을 입력 후 적용->확인 누르고 톰캣 재기동하면 해결된다.